We took this tired and worn out old painted front porch and made it look like a million buck$. We gave this the same treatment we do our garage floors. We mechanically grind the surface to remove any failing coating and provide a good profile for the epoxy to bite in to. Once everything is prepped, we then apply the 2 part epoxy with vinyl chip flakes of your choice and colors. We come back the next day to remove any excess flake and apply a super durable clear polyaspartic top coat that is bullet proof. We also painted the railings and all sides of the porch.
